Ms. Koizumi Loves Ramen Noodles Volume 1

For reasons she can’t completely explain, high school student Yu likes the cool and seemingly mysterious transfer student, Koizumi, and wants to get to know her better.

She soon enough learns that one way (or in some cases, learns it’s not the way!) is through enjoying some ramen.

Ms. Koizumi Loves Ramen Noodles is one manga where you can tell the creator really enjoys showing why a certain thing is awesome — in this case, it’s ramen! After watching it in anime form, you also got that sense too, alongside me just wanting to make eating different types of ramen a habit in my life.

But now it’s in manga form, and the results are about the same. It’s likely not going to be the manga to reinvent your thinking that cute girls doing a specific thing can be super entertaining, especially if food manga isn’t your thing.

But for a first volume it does enough to leave you wanting a bit more.

While we are introduced to Koizumi and her knowledge of ramen, we are also introduced to Misa and Jun, who each make a certain breakthrough with Koizumi thanks to simply going to a place and either eating the spiciest or the oddest sounding ramen there is. Meanwhile, Yu only manages to get more distant from Koizumi despite her every attempt at trying to know her (so yes, stalking is bad) — until a chance event leads to Yu actually making some ramen for her.

Like I said, this is wholly centered on one thing: ramen. So the big draw would be not only the different types you can eat, but even how it’s made. Even not being discerning of what type of ramen is being eaten (instant for example) can make a difference. So can the art, which is somewhat in the realm of Food Wars, but the manga mostly shows these four girls enjoying the taste of these noodles.

Between that and the length of these chapters, you’ll find yourself likely finishing Ms. Koizumi Loves Ramen Noodles in quick fashion. There’s also a chance you’ll find yourself wanting to eat more ramen, so it’s totally recommended you have something to eat before reading this. But that’s only if you’re looking for a nice, relaxing manga involving cute girls about to eat a ton of ramen for a good while.
